Maintaining Proper Nutrition for Your Pet
Ensuring your animal companion receives a nutritious diet is crucial for their overall health and well-being. Just like humans, animals require a variety of vitamins to thrive. A well-rounded diet should include the right ratios of protein, fats, carbohydrates, and key elements. Understanding your animal's individual requirements, based on their species, age, activity level, and health condition, is essential in crafting a appropriate dietary plan.
- Consult your veterinarian for personalized advice on the best diet for your animal.
- Read food labels carefully and choose products that meet AAFCO (Association of American Feed Control Officials) standards.
- Offer a variety of foods to ensure a diverse intake of nutrients.
- Provide fresh water at all times.
By following these guidelines, you can help your animal enjoy a long, healthy life fueled by a balanced diet.
